| Admin delete option for confirmed phishing in Microsoft Forms |
| MC228517 | December 4 - Admins will have two ways to delete a form that has been confirmed for phishing. Before this update, after an admin confirmed phishing, the form would be blocked permanently. In other words, the form owner would be unable to edit or delete the form. |

| Shifts app groups will automatically have a tag in Teams |
| MC228393 | December 3 - The Shifts app in Microsoft Teams keeps workers connected and in sync. With this update, every group in the Shifts app will automatically have a tag in Teams. This feature means team members do not need to know the names of on-shift employees in order to communicate with them in a timely manner.This message is associated with Microsoft 365 Roadmap ID 64972. |
